How it works
Three steps, ten minutes a day
01
Watch the scene
A short animated vignette of daily life in Louisville, made at your English level from A1 to B2.
02
Practice out loud
Talk to the voice partner about what you saw. It waits, it repeats, and it never judges.
03
Track your progress
Your minutes and finished scenes are saved to your account — nothing else is.

Good to know
- Does it cost anything?
- No. Louisville Voice is free to use, with no ads and no upsell.
- What information do you keep?
- An email address and a username. That is all — no address, no phone number, no immigration status.
- What if I don't know the English word?
- Say it in your own language. The partner understands 13 languages and will help you find the English words.
- Do I need a microphone?
- Any phone or laptop microphone works. Your browser will ask permission the first time.
